Instacart’s Holiday Pay Policies
Instacart does indeed offer higher pay rates on holidays. The company recognizes the increased demand for its services during the festive season and aims to incentivize shoppers to work during these peak times. The exact pay rates can vary depending on the specific holiday and the local market, but generally, Instacart offers a premium pay rate for shoppers to work on holidays.
For example, during major holidays like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Year’s Eve, Instacart typically increases the pay rate by 1.5 to 2 times the regular rate. This means that shoppers can earn significantly more during these peak periods. Additionally, Instacart may also offer bonuses or incentives for shoppers who work extended hours or complete a certain number of orders during the holiday season.
